CLEVELAND, OH (WOIO) –

The Women’s March on Cleveland will take place Saturday from Public Square. Hundreds of demonstrators are expected to show support for women’s rights and oppose the negative rhetoric of the past election cycle. More than 300 similar protests are planned nationwide.

Demonstrators will meet at Public Square for opening marks. At 11 a.m. the march will step off and proceed down Ontario Street and Lakeside Avenue, stopping at City Hall and Willard Park. Participants will circle back to Public Square for closing remarks.

Organizers say this will be a non-partisan event and everyone is welcome.
